Place summary

Beinn a' Chuirn is a mountain located in the Scottish Highlands. It is part of the larger range of hills that characterise this rugged region. Visitors can expect challenging terrain and scenic views, typical of the Highland landscape. The area is popular for hiking and offers a chance to experience the natural beauty of Scotland's wilderness.
